What do I need for Verizon Fios service? Verizon Fios requires an Optical Network Terminal that can receive the signal, but this is included with your monthly service. Verizon also includes a router so that you can access the fiber optic service from all of the devices in your home. Should...

Verizon MVNOs (Mobile Virtual Network Operators) are wireless providers that don’t have cell towers. Instead, they purchase access to Verizon’s towers. This allows them to offer you cellular service under their own brand names. Here’s how they go about doing this: ...

Even if Verizon 5G Home Internet is available in your city, there's no guarantee you can get it at your address. Service requires proximity to Verizon's 5G cell towers and a strong, steady signal. My former CNET colleague, for example, lived near downtownLouisville, Kentucky, where Verizon...
